			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><center><img src="http://www.2dayblog.com/images/2009/july/2ndaquarium.jpg" title="Kuroshio Sea" alt="Kuroshio Sea" /></center></p>
<p>The video was shot at the Okinawa Churaumi Aquarium in Japan. It is the main tank called Kuroshio Sea that holds up 7,500-cubic meters (1,981,290 gallons) of water and it has been claimed as the world&#8217;s second largest aquarium, with acrylic glass panel, measuring 8.2 meters by 22.5 meters with a thickness of 60 centimeters. &#8220;Whale sharks and manta rays are kept amongst many other fish species in the main tank.&#8221;. Video after the break.<span id="more-11020"></span></p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><center><img src="http://www.2dayblog.com/images/2008/november/mcdonalds_japan.jpg" alt="" ></center></p>
<p>The above is the McDonalds restaurant in Japan. Yes there are something missing, that’s right the Ronald and the golden arches. McDonald had just launched the quarter pounder burger in Japan and to attract more people, they have converted two outlets in Tokyo to exclusive Quarter Pounder shops. Yup, these restaurants will come without Ronald and the golden arches, everything seems different from usual one, it has a sleek, minimalist black interior with Le Corbusier sofas and they have red and black packaging. It looks expensive…</p>
